aboutsummaryrefslogtreecommitdiff
path: root/graphics/py-pydot
diff options
context:
space:
mode:
authorStefan Walter <stefan@FreeBSD.org>2008-09-10 15:55:46 +0000
committerStefan Walter <stefan@FreeBSD.org>2008-09-10 15:55:46 +0000
commit8adc12fbc60025158c4e872fd8b6b6ca6cdfa7dd (patch)
tree080abb57877a13e81eeebaa83845c922855dc39e /graphics/py-pydot
parent04a7f54913dd5df5be69b3aa5dcf0415f711d691 (diff)
downloadports-8adc12fbc60025158c4e872fd8b6b6ca6cdfa7dd.tar.gz
ports-8adc12fbc60025158c4e872fd8b6b6ca6cdfa7dd.zip
- Patch setup.py to avoid using easy_install instead of distutils, which leads
to unclean deinstallation. - Move PROJECTHOST out of the PORTNAME section to satisfy portlint. PR: 127260 Submitted by: Yi-Jheng Lin <yzlin@cs.nctu.edu.tw> Approved by: portmgr (pav)
Notes
Notes: svn path=/head/; revision=220323
Diffstat (limited to 'graphics/py-pydot')
-rw-r--r--graphics/py-pydot/Makefile3
-rw-r--r--graphics/py-pydot/files/patch-setup.py18
2 files changed, 18 insertions, 3 deletions
diff --git a/graphics/py-pydot/Makefile b/graphics/py-pydot/Makefile
index 9812799c2741..f6b83c8c5002 100644
--- a/graphics/py-pydot/Makefile
+++ b/graphics/py-pydot/Makefile
@@ -7,10 +7,10 @@
PORTNAME= pydot
PORTVERSION= 1.0.2
+PORTREVISION= 1
CATEGORIES= graphics python
MASTER_SITES= ${MASTER_SITE_GOOGLE_CODE}
P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X}
-PROJECTHOST= ${PORTNAME}
MAINTAINER= stefan@FreeBSD.org
COMMENT= A Python interface to the Graphviz Dot language
@@ -19,6 +19,7 @@ BUILD_DEPENDS= ${PYTHON_SITELIBDIR}/pyparsing.py:${PORTSDIR}/devel/py-parsing
RUN_DEPENDS= ${PYTHON_SITELIBDIR}/pyparsing.py:${PORTSDIR}/devel/py-parsing \
dot:${PORTSDIR}/graphics/graphviz
+PROJECTHOST= ${PORTNAME}
USE_PYTHON= yes
USE_PYDISTUTILS=yes
diff --git a/graphics/py-pydot/files/patch-setup.py b/graphics/py-pydot/files/patch-setup.py
index a3954c60801f..a633069c59b0 100644
--- a/graphics/py-pydot/files/patch-setup.py
+++ b/graphics/py-pydot/files/patch-setup.py
@@ -1,5 +1,19 @@
---- setup.py.orig 2008-07-06 15:01:26.000000000 +0200
-+++ setup.py 2008-07-06 15:01:51.000000000 +0200
+--- setup.py.orig 2008-02-15 04:48:02.000000000 +0800
++++ setup.py 2008-09-10 11:12:00.000000000 +0800
+@@ -1,9 +1,9 @@
+ #!/usr/bin/env python
+
+-try:
+- from setuptools import setup
+-except ImportError, excp:
+- from distutils.core import setup
++#try:
++# from setuptools import setup
++#except ImportError, excp:
++from distutils.core import setup
+
+ import pydot
+
@@ -27,5 +27,5 @@
'Topic :: Software Development :: Libraries :: Python Modules'],
long_description = "\n".join(pydot.__doc__.split('\n')),